Prepare for an extraordinary challenge with the Crazies Trifecta, a unique event taking place from March 6-8, 2026, based in scenic Rainsville, Alabama. This isn't just one race, but three distinct half marathons run on three consecutive days, totaling an impressive 39.3 miles through DeKalb County. Typical race day conditions in early March offer pleasant running weather, with highs around 60F and lows dipping to 38F, alongside a 20% chance of precipitation.
The Crazies Trifecta embraces a "no-frills" philosophy, focusing purely on the joy of running, camaraderie, and personal achievement. Participants should be prepared for a self-supported adventure, as there will be no timing, no water stations, and no prize money. Each day presents a new course as you embark on a tour of DeKalb County, with starting locations emailed two weeks prior to the event. Expect miles and mountains, promising scenic views and a true test of endurance.
What makes this race truly special is the inherent challenge of completing 39.3 miles over three days. Only those who conquer all three half marathons will earn custom Crazies Trifecta swag, a well-deserved reward for an exceptional feat. Limited to just 100 participants, this event, organized by "Jerry's Crazies," fosters a close-knit and supportive atmosphere. Beyond the personal accomplishment, your participation contributes to local causes, as all proceeds benefit Rainsville Freedom Run charities, and every registrant automatically receives a free entry into the Rainsville Freedom Run in June 2026.
